The Evolving Threat Landscape
The Rise of AI-Powered Attacks:
Artificial intelligence is rapidly transforming cybersecurity, both defensively and offensively. Malicious actors are increasingly utilizing AI for sophisticated phishing campaigns, creating highly personalized scams that bypass traditional security measures. AI can also automate attacks, making them more frequent and harder to detect. This necessitates a shift towards AI-powered defenses, including advanced threat detection systems and proactive security measures.
The Expansion of the Internet of Things (IoT):
The proliferation of IoT devices creates an exponentially larger attack surface. Many IoT devices lack robust security protocols, making them easy targets for hackers. This poses a significant risk, as compromised IoT devices can be used to launch larger attacks against networks and critical infrastructure. Secure device selection, regular firmware updates, and network segmentation are crucial for mitigating this risk.
The Growing Sophistication of Ransomware Attacks:
Ransomware remains a persistent threat, evolving to become more targeted, destructive, and difficult to recover from. Double extortion attacks, where data is both encrypted and exfiltrated, are becoming increasingly common. This requires a multi-layered approach to ransomware defense, including robust data backups, employee training on phishing awareness, and advanced endpoint detection and response (EDR) systems.
Strategies for Protecting Your Data in the Future
Embrace Zero Trust Security:
Zero trust security models assume no implicit trust, verifying every user and device before granting access to resources. This approach drastically reduces the impact of successful breaches, as compromised accounts will have limited privileges. Implementing a zero-trust architecture involves strong authentication, micro-segmentation, and continuous monitoring.
Invest in Advanced Threat Detection and Response (ATDR):
Traditional security solutions often struggle to keep up with the speed and sophistication of modern cyberattacks. ATDR solutions leverage AI and machine learning to detect and respond to threats in real-time, minimizing damage and accelerating incident response. These solutions are essential for proactively identifying and neutralizing sophisticated attacks before they can cause significant harm.
Prioritize Cybersecurity Training and Awareness:
Human error remains a significant vulnerability in any cybersecurity strategy. Investing in robust cybersecurity awareness training for employees is crucial. This training should cover phishing scams, social engineering tactics, and best practices for password security and data handling. Regular training and simulated phishing exercises are essential to maintain a high level of awareness.
Implement Robust Data Backup and Recovery:
Data backups are critical for mitigating the impact of ransomware and other data breaches. Employing a 3-2-1 backup strategy (3 copies of your data, on 2 different media types, with 1 offsite copy) ensures data availability even in the event of a catastrophic event. Regularly testing your backup and recovery processes is crucial to ensure they function as expected.
